Authorities say a 68-year-old handyman fell to his death from atop a four-story apartment building in Little Havana.
Miami Fire-Rescue spokesman Lt. Ignatius Carroll says the man was near the ledge and appeared to be installing weather stripping when he fell. He died around 2:15 p.m.
The Miami Herald reports the man fell about 40 feet and hit the ground in a grassy area near the parking lot. He was already dead when paramedics arrived.
The man’s name has not been released. But his brother told responders that he heard the man scream and then heard a loud thump.
Carroll told the newspaper he wasn’t sure if there was any safety equipment in use to protect workers if they fell.
